释义
n.

Economics a supposed inverse relationship between the level of unemployment and the rate of inflation

【经济】 (表示失业率和通货膨胀率之间相反关系的)菲利普斯曲线。

词源

"1960s: named after Alban W. H. Phillips (1914—75), New Zealand economist."
